Half-day Budapest wine tour to Etyek-Buda with family winery tastings and Hungarian food. Options include lunch or dinner.

Sip five indigenous Hungarian wines in a 19th-century Budapest cellar with cheese, charcuterie, bread, and mineral water. English, 90 minutes.
